Output db61d918aff6079d5ef269995117d32c58f2e3626bf78bf8631fb6531dce6ec3:0

value
740371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38e5217487232322879ffb09284ccca3eea1113a OP_EQUALVERIFY OP_CHECKSIG
address
16BqL2FVyY3y98UG5jp4xqWoZWkGYcneL8
transaction
db61d918aff6079d5ef269995117d32c58f2e3626bf78bf8631fb6531dce6ec3
spent
true